Huge fire injures 16 in the Bronx

Appears to have started in furniture store

The Fire Department of New York says 16 people have been hurt in a fire raging through a Bronx building.

Four of them seriously are in a critical condition.

Officials say over 200 firefighters have responded to the blaze at a four-story building near the Bronx Zoo in Van Nest. It was reported about 5.30am on Tuesday morning.

WABC-TV reports there are twelve apartments in the building, but the blaze appears to have started in a first-floor furniture store.

The blaze comes only days after the deadliest residential fire to hit New York City in at least a quarter century swept through a Bronx apartment building, killing 12 people.
